The family office wealth management landscape in Panama, and across Latin America, has undergone a significant transformation in recent years. Today, high-net-worth and ultra-high-net-worth individuals increasingly seek structured, strategic approaches to preserve and grow their wealth. Panama, long recognized as a regional financial hub with a favorable tax regime, remains a key player in this evolving ecosystem. Yet, it too must adapt to rising demands for transparency, international compliance, and digital innovation.

Family offices in Latin America face a host of pressing challenges. These include navigating complex cross-border tax regulations, succession planning, managing currency volatility, and mitigating socio-political risks. As many family-owned enterprises transition to second- and third generation leadership, the need for professional wealth management has never been greater. This shift is accelerating the move from traditional, informal structures to more institutionalized family office models that emphasize governance, risk management, and customized investment strategies.

Leading advisors in the space embrace technology-driven solutions, ESG oriented investments, and diversification across asset classes and geographies. With its strategic location, robust financial infrastructure, and commitment to aligning with global compliance standards, Panama is well-positioned as a regional launchpad for innovation in family wealth management.

Despite ongoing challenges, the region offers tremendous opportunities. A growing number of affluent individuals, increasing awareness of generational wealth planning, and heightened interest in alternative investments drive demand for sophisticated, future-ready family office solutions.
